SO - T-ReduceTournament: Plano West Classic | Round: Octas | Opponent: Southlake Carroll EP | Judge: Demarcus Powell, Wendy Curran Meyer, Mohammad Sheikh 1
Interpretation: Reduce means to lower in amount or make smaller.Cambridge English Dictionary In legal context – it still means lower in amountFindLaw Legal Dictionary AND International legal code uses 'Reduce' in context of lower in degree or amount – warming remedies proveHunter '21 Violation: They ~only delay patents ~Delay is not a reductionMeriamm Webster No Date Delays do not stop or prevent an action – Traffic may delay you but it does not stop you from getting to your destinationCambridge English Dictionary No Date Limits – Anything else explodes the caselist since the aff could delay IPP to any arbitrary end or change IPP in any possible way – there is no boundary to restrict them in how they change IPP. Only reduce grants the neg some predictable stasis for prep by researching about why IPP is good and so why a world without IPP is bad. Limits outweighs on depth – anything else means the neg reads generics like the Kant NC or a Security K without ever engaging the aff.Ground – All negative ground is based on IP good. The Innovation DA, Heg DA, Politics DA, Counterfeits turn, Pharmaceutical Backlash turn, Bioterror turn, etc all link to a removal of IP protections. A lack of modification guts neg ground since none of our offense would link to the aff. Ground outweighs on necessity – we can't have a debate if one side does not have arguments to read.Paradigm Issues1 – Drop the debater – their abusive advocacy skewed the debate from the start and we can't come back2 - Comes before 1AR theory — A - If we had to be abusive it's because it was impossible to engage their aff, B – Neg abuse outweighs aff abuse because we control the depth of the debate if we can't engage depth is impossible3 - Use competing interps on T – A – T is a yes/no question, you can't be half topical or mostly topical B - reasonability invites arbitrary judge intervention and a race to the bottom of questionable argumentation4 - No RVIs – A - Forcing the 1NC to go all in on the shell kills substance education and neg strat, B - discourages checking real abuse C - Encourages baiting – outweighs because if the shell is frivolous, they can beat it quick | 10/24/21 |
